Bug#536468: ITP: libumem -- Solaris slab allocator

2009-07-10 Thread Monty Taylor
Package: wnpp
Owner: Monty Taylor 
Severity: wishlist

* Package name: libumem
  Version : 1.0.1
  Upstream Author : Message Systems, Inc.
* URL : http://labs.omniti.com/trac/portableumem
* License : CDDL
  Programming Lang: C
  Description : Solaris slab allocator

libumem is a port of the slab memory allocator from Solaris. It provides
runtime creation of slabs with per-cpu caching to reduce cpu contention
during memory allocation.

libumem also provides advanced memory debugging information and a
programmatic interface for creating object caches back by the heap or
memory mapped files.

Bug#514769: marked as done (ITA: inadyn -- client to alleviate the requirements for an Internet name)

2009-07-10 Thread Debian Bug Tracking System

Your message dated Fri, 10 Jul 2009 09:47:15 +
with message-id 
and subject line Bug#514769: fixed in inadyn 1.96.2-1
has caused the Debian Bug report #514769,
regarding ITA: inadyn -- client to alleviate the requirements for an Internet 
name
to be marked as done.

This means that you claim that the problem has been dealt with.
If this is not the case it is now your responsibility to reopen the
Bug report if necessary, and/or fix the problem forthwith.

(NB: If you are a system administrator and have no idea what this
message is talking about, this may indicate a serious mail system
misconfiguration somewhere. Please contact ow...@bugs.debian.org
immediately.)


-- 
514769: http://bugs.debian.org/cgi-bin/bugreport.cgi?bug=514769
Debian Bug Tracking System
Contact ow...@bugs.debian.org with problems
--- Begin Message ---
Package: wnpp
Severity: normal

I intend to orphan the inadyn package.

The package description is:
 With this package the user can have an Internet name for his host
 even though he might not have a registered domain name, a static IP,
 or run a name server.  It works by being a client of a supposedly open
 name server and updating the server's records when the need arise.
 This is sometimes reffered to as ddns, which is a shorthand for dynamic
 DNS.  http://inadyn.ina-tech.net has a link to a better defintion of
 what Dynamic DNS system is. It also carries a list of service
 providers.  Some of these services are free of charge.
 .
 This is a command line tool that is written in portable ANSI C with a
 little OS abstraction layer.  It is using a Multi-protocol file
 transfer library, which is ported to all the main operating systems,
 for the network related stuff.  It can maintain multiple host names
 and multiple service providers with the same IP address, and has a
 web based IP detection which runs well behind a NAT router.
 .
 Home page: http://inadyn.ina-tech.net


Note: The original upstream lost interest a long time ago.

Bug#536493: ITP: xmount -- tool to crossmount between multiple input and output image files

2009-07-10 Thread Michael Prokop
Package: wnpp
Severity: wishlist
Owner: Michael Prokop 


* Package name: xmount
  Version : 0.3.1
  Upstream Author : Gillen Daniel 
* URL : https://www.pinguin.lu/
* License : GPL
  Programming Lang: C
  Description : tool to crossmount between multiple input and output image 
files

  xmount allows you to convert on-the-fly between multiple
  input and output image types. xmount creates a virtual file
  system using FUSE (Filesystem in Userspace) that contains a
  virtual representation of the input image. The virtual
  representation can be in raw DD or in VirtualBox's virtual
  disk file format. Input images can be raw DD or EWF (Expert
  Witness Compression Format).  In addition, xmount also
  supports virtual write access to the output files that is
  redirected to a cache file. This makes it for example
  possible to use VirtualBox to boot an OS contained in a
  read-only EWF image.

Bug#536550: ITP: libguard-perl -- safe cleanup blocks

2009-07-10 Thread Jonathan Yu
Package: wnpp
Owner: Jonathan Yu 
Severity: wishlist
X-Debbugs-CC: debian-de...@lists.debian.org

* Package name: libguard-perl
  Version : 1.02
  Upstream Author : (information incomplete)
* URL : http://search.cpan.org/dist/Guard/
* License : Artistic | GPL-1+
  Programming Lang: Perl
  Description : safe cleanup blocks

 Guard implements so-called "guards". A guard is something (usually an object)
 that "guards" a resource, ensuring that it is cleaned up when expected.
 .
 Specifically, this module supports two different types of guards: guard
 objects, which execute a given code block when destroyed, and scoped guards,
 which are tied to the scope exit.

Bug#536551: ITP: libcoro-perl -- the only real threads in perl

2009-07-10 Thread Jonathan Yu
Package: wnpp
Owner: Jonathan Yu 
Severity: wishlist
X-Debbugs-CC: debian-de...@lists.debian.org

* Package name: libcoro-perl
  Version : 5.151
  Upstream Author : (information incomplete)
* URL : http://search.cpan.org/dist/Coro/
* License : Artistic | GPL-1+
  Programming Lang: Perl
  Description : the only real threads in perl

 Coro collection manages continuations in general, most often in the form of
 cooperative threads (also called coros, or simply "coro" in the
 documentation). They are similar to kernel threads but don't (in general) run
 in parallel at the same time even on SMP machines. The specific flavor of
 thread offered by this module also guarantees you that it will not switch
 between threads unless necessary, at easily-identified points in your
 program, so locking and parallel access are rarely an issue, making thread
 programming much safer and easier than using other thread models.
 .
 Unlike the so-called "Perl threads" (which are not actually real threads but
 only the windows process emulation ported to unix, and as such act as
 processes), Coro provides a full shared address space, which makes
 communication between threads very easy. And Coro's threads are fast, too:
 disabling the Windows process emulation code in your perl and using Coro can
 easily result in a two to four times speed increase for your programs. A
 parallel matrix multiplication benchmark runs over 300 times faster on a
 single core than perl's pseudo-threads on a quad core using all four cores.
